Questions about this program

How big is the program signal?

Biology, General accounts for 9.6% of reported programs at Hanover College, which is bigger than 94% of schools in this field set and 2.5x the national average concentration. The enrollment proxy is about 99 students when that share is applied to current enrollment.

How should I read the cost number?

Hanover College's average net price is $21,829 per year, about $87,316 over four years. That is $3,052 above the $18,777 peer average, before your own aid package changes the final bill.

Are the earnings major-specific?

No. The $53,957 median earnings figure is school-wide ten years after entry. It is $934 below the $54,891 average among schools reporting this field, so treat it as an outcomes proxy rather than a department guarantee.
